How much horsepower does a GY6 have?

Building upon that technology a newer motor, the Honda GY6 engine, was produced in the 1980s. This is a 4-stroke, single cylinder, air or oil cooled design that comes standard with two overhead valves. Stock horsepower ratings can be found quoted in the range of 7.8 hp (5.8 kW) to 12.4 hp (9.2 kW).

Who uses GY6 engine?

The GY6 engine design is a four-stroke single-cylinder in a near horizontal orientation that is used on a number of small motorcycles or scooters made in Taiwan, China, and other southeast Asian countries.

Are Chinese GY6 engines reliable?

GY6 Engines are commonly used in ATVs, Scooters, Dunebuggies/GoKarts, and select snowmobile applications as well. These engines are fairly quiet in operation and actually quite reliable when paired with quality external parts.

Who invented GY6 engine?

About the Engine Now abandoned by Honda it has been licensed to several Chinese and Taiwanese engine producers. Old Honda made GY6. The engine design is a single-cylinder, four-stroke engine, in a horizontal orientation. It is by fan air cooled, anf has a chain-driven overhead camshaft with a crossflow hemi head.
